
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u alleged that Iran attempted to murder one of his sons, though he provided no specific details regarding the timing or location of the plot.
The claim follows the recent deaths of Iranian Supreme Leader Ali Khamenei and four family members, including his daughter Boshra and granddaughter Zahra, in a joint US-Israeli strike.
Netanyahu's son Yair, 35, has been under extended personal protection since July, alongside his brother and mother, amid heightened security concerns ahead of the October general election.
